An endpoint that is only sending ACK frames will not receive acknowledgments
from its peer unless those acknowledgments are included in packets with
ack-eliciting frames. An endpoint SHOULD send an ACK frame with other frames
when there are new ack-eliciting packets to acknowledge. When only
non-ack-eliciting packets need to be acknowledged, an endpoint MAY wait until an
ack-eliciting packet has been received to include an ACK frame with outgoing
frames.

A receiver that is only sending non-ack-eliciting packets might choose to
occasionally add an ack-eliciting frame to those packets to ensure that it
receives an acknowledgment; see {{ack-tracking}}. A receiver MUST NOT send an
ack-eliciting frame in all packets that would otherwise be non-ack-eliciting, to
avoid an infinite feedback loop of acknowledgments.
